Broken Key Extraction
Forest Hills’s older estate homes from the 1970s through the 1990s often have original Baldwin or Medeco locksets with worn keyways. A key snaps off at the worst moment, usually when you’re rushing out the door. Our technicians carry precision extractors and can cut a replacement key on-site. We also check the lock cylinder for damage - a broken key often signals a deeper problem that will strand you again if it’s not addressed. For homes in the teardown-rebuild cycle, we frequently extract broken keys from contractor-installed temporary locks that were never meant for long-term use.

Safe Opening
Forest Hills estates commonly have floor safes, wall safes, and gun safes - many with forgotten combinations or failed electronic locks. We open safes without drilling whenever possible, preserving the integrity of your security container. Our technicians are trained on major safe brands and carry specialized tools for manipulation and bypass. We’ve opened safes in homes off Old Hickory Boulevard where the original owner passed away and the combination was never recorded, and in new builds where the general contractor installed a safe but never provided the owner with the factory code.

Pricing for Emergency Locksmith in Forest Hills, TN
Here’s what typical emergency locksmith work costs in Forest Hills:
- House lockout (standard residential): $89-$145
- High-security lockout (Medeco, Mul-T-Lock, Baldwin Estate): $145-$225
- Broken key extraction: $95-$165
- Safe opening (non-destructive): $175-$275
- Emergency rekey (per cylinder): $25-$45 plus service call
- Eviction lock change (full replacement): $125-$195 per door
What affects your price: the type of lock (high-security cylinders take longer), time of day (we don’t charge extra for nights or weekends, but complex jobs after hours may require additional technician time), and whether parts need replacement versus repair.
